#include "config.h"
#include "gtlsinputstream-gnutls.h"
static void g_tls_input_stream_gnutls_pollable_iface_init (GPollableInputStreamInterface *iface);
G_DEFINE_TYPE_WITH_CODE (GTlsInputStreamGnutls, g_tls_input_stream_gnutls, G_TYPE_INPUT_STREAM,
G_IMPLEMENT_INTERFACE (G_TYPE_POLLABLE_INPUT_STREAM, g_tls_input_stream_gnutls_pollable_iface_init)
)
struct _GTlsInputStreamGnutlsPrivate
{
GTlsConnectionGnutls *conn;
};
static void
g_tls_input_stream_gnutls_dispose (GObject *object)
{
GTlsInputStreamGnutls *stream = G_TLS_INPUT_STREAM_GNUTLS (object);
if (stream->priv->conn)
{
g_object_remove_weak_pointer (G_OBJECT (stream->priv->conn),
(gpointer *)&stream->priv->conn);
stream->priv->conn = NULL;
}
G_OBJECT_CLASS (g_tls_input_stream_gnutls_parent_class)->dispose (object);
}
static gssize
g_tls_input_stream_gnutls_read (GInputStream *stream,
void *buffer,
gsize count,
GCancellable *cancellable,
GError **error)
{
GTlsInputStreamGnutls *tls_stream = G_TLS_INPUT_STREAM_GNUTLS (stream);
g_return_val_if_fail (tls_stream->priv->conn != NULL, -1);
return g_tls_connection_gnutls_read (tls_stream->priv->conn,
buffer, count, TRUE,
cancellable, error);
}
static gboolean
g_tls_input_stream_gnutls_pollable_is_readable (GPollableInputStream *pollable)
{
GTlsInputStreamGnutls *tls_stream = G_TLS_INPUT_STREAM_GNUTLS (pollable);
g_return_val_if_fail (tls_stream->priv->conn != NULL, FALSE);
return g_tls_connection_gnutls_check (tls_stream->priv->conn, G_IO_IN);
}
static GSource *
g_tls_input_stream_gnutls_pollable_create_source (GPollableInputStream *pollable,
GCancellable *cancellable)
{
GTlsInputStreamGnutls *tls_stream = G_TLS_INPUT_STREAM_GNUTLS (pollable);
g_return_val_if_fail (tls_stream->priv->conn != NULL, NULL);
return g_tls_connection_gnutls_create_source (tls_stream->priv->conn,
G_IO_IN,
cancellable);
}
static gssize
g_tls_input_stream_gnutls_pollable_read_nonblocking (GPollableInputStream *pollable,
void *buffer,
gsize size,
GError **error)
{
GTlsInputStreamGnutls *tls_stream = G_TLS_INPUT_STREAM_GNUTLS (pollable);
return g_tls_connection_gnutls_read (tls_stream->priv->conn,
buffer, size, FALSE,
NULL, error);
}
static void
g_tls_input_stream_gnutls_class_init (GTlsInputStreamGnutlsClass *klass)
{
GObjectClass *gobject_class = G_OBJECT_CLASS (klass);
GInputStreamClass *input_stream_class = G_INPUT_STREAM_CLASS (klass);
g_type_class_add_private (klass, sizeof (GTlsInputStreamGnutlsPrivate));
gobject_class->dispose = g_tls_input_stream_gnutls_dispose;
input_stream_class->read_fn = g_tls_input_stream_gnutls_read;
}
static void
g_tls_input_stream_gnutls_pollable_iface_init (GPollableInputStreamInterface *iface)
{
iface->is_readable = g_tls_input_stream_gnutls_pollable_is_readable;
iface->create_source = g_tls_input_stream_gnutls_pollable_create_source;
iface->read_nonblocking = g_tls_input_stream_gnutls_pollable_read_nonblocking;
}
static void
g_tls_input_stream_gnutls_init (GTlsInputStreamGnutls *stream)
{
stream->priv = G_TYPE_INSTANCE_GET_PRIVATE (stream, G_TYPE_TLS_INPUT_STREAM_GNUTLS, GTlsInputStreamGnutlsPrivate);
}
GInputStream *
g_tls_input_stream_gnutls_new (GTlsConnectionGnutls *conn)
{
GTlsInputStreamGnutls *tls_stream;
tls_stream = g_object_new (G_TYPE_TLS_INPUT_STREAM_GNUTLS, NULL);
tls_stream->priv->conn = conn;
g_object_add_weak_pointer (G_OBJECT (conn),
(gpointer *)&tls_stream->priv->conn);
return G_INPUT_STREAM (tls_stream);
}
